Output 26d2e657d87101ac99af5cd04b6be04417143b4217acd69bace66e2637c4a7ab:4

value
52026103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955f69a4a2405a1a366ac5cb8b3463eff2e1cba7 OP_EQUAL
address
3FJpuWpPq1h9vjifxRu4Tcgehaje3Bmr8N
transaction
26d2e657d87101ac99af5cd04b6be04417143b4217acd69bace66e2637c4a7ab
spent
true